Der eigentliche Node.js-Prozess lauscht innerhalb des Testaufbaus auf `127.0.0.1:47146`. Davor läuft ein ausschließlich für die Tests bestimmter Reverse-Proxy auf `http://127.0.0.1:47145`, sodass dieser Loopback-Endpunkt das einzige Ziel der API-Aufrufe bleibt. Der Produktivserver wird von der Testsuite nicht angesprochen. + +Der lokale Proxy lässt `GET`, `HEAD` und `OPTIONS` ohne Anmeldung passieren. Für `POST`, `PUT`, `PATCH` und `DELETE` antwortet er zunächst mit `401 Unauthorized` und `WWW-Authenticate: Basic`, sofern kein gültiger Authorization-Header vorhanden ist. Nach erfolgreicher Basic-Auth-Prüfung entfernt der Proxy den Header wieder und leitet den Request an den lokal per NPM gestarteten Server weiter. Damit wird ein möglicher Nginx-Passwortschutz für schreibende Operationen realistisch simuliert, ohne Authentifizierung in die Anwendung selbst einzubauen. + +Der Integrationstest prüft dabei ausdrücklich, dass lesende Requests nicht präventiv authentifiziert werden und dass für `POST`, `PUT` und `DELETE` jeweils zuerst ein `401` und anschließend ein erfolgreicher authentifizierter Request erfolgt. Zusätzlich bleibt ein kleiner, isolierter HTTP-Mock auf einem zufälligen Loopback-Port bestehen, der die 401-Wiederholungslogik der Python-Request-Schicht unabhängig vom vollständigen REST-Test prüft. + ## Technische Hinweise - Medienpfade werden relativ zu `storage/` gespeichert. Antwortet ein vorgeschalteter Webserver mit `401 Unauthorized`, verwendet die gemeinsame Request-Schicht zuerst die Umgebungsvariablen `API_USER` und `API_PASSWORD`. Sind beide gesetzt, wird derselbe Request genau mit diesen Basic-Auth-Credentials wiederholt. Fehlen sie, fragt das Werkzeug Benutzername und Passwort interaktiv ab. Das Passwort wird mit `getpass` ohne Bildschirmausgabe eingelesen. Führende und nachgestellte Whitespaces werden aus beiden Umgebungsvariablen entfernt; reine Whitespace-Werte gelten als nicht gesetzt. Für unbeaufsichtigte Aufrufe und CI-Pipelines:
